Throughout his time as a football manager, Alan Pardew has never failed to astound me with some of his actions, behaviour and comments.

Buying players from foreign Leagues (mostly Ligue 1) at cut-price has been a fixture of Alan Pardew’s reign at Newcastle. As such, it’s a little bizarre to hear the man suggest that there might be ‘too many’ foreign players at St James’ Park.

Let’s take a look at his comments: “One issue is that we’re going to need to look at British players quickly because we’re starting to get filled up with perhaps too many foreign players. I think we need to strengthen the team and maybe in January as well.” (Source: The Mirror)

Whilst some fans may nod along in agreement, it has to be noted that Alan Pardew is at fault for this. If anyone has disturbed the balance of Newcastle United, it’s Pardew, who seems to have grabbed at French footballers whenever possible over the last 12 or so months.

Some of these players, have adapted well to English football. The likes of Yohan Cabaye, Loic Remy and Mathieu Debuchy have elevated the Magpies.

Papiss Cisse also did a good job for the club, at least for a season. Moussa Sissoko also had a fine start to his career with the Toon. In recent times, however, both players have looked burned out.

A lot of Newcastle’s other foreign recruits have struggled to make their mark. I think it’s fair to say that the mix isn’t quite right at the moment, not just in terms of nationality, but also in terms of talent and ability.

Isn’t that what this all comes down to? Alan Pardew wouldn’t be making these comments if his team were performing well enough (they’re currently 11th in the Premier League table).

But because Newcastle should be aiming for a top six slot, Pardew has to make excuses. But the suggestion that the Toon lack English grit, doesn’t really fly with me. The real issue with Newcastle is that Pardew hasn’t built a well-rounded team and that many players aren’t good enough to be playing for a top six club.

Adding more British players to this team is probably a good idea. Adding better players is an even better idea. Adding top quality players in positions that Newcastle currently need to improve upon, is a better idea still.

I only hope that Pardew understands this and doesn’t make further excuses come the end of the season.
